Following the successful execution of an exclusive distribution agreement with a Kuwaiti partner for select countries in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region and the commencement of official shipments, Bio Preventive Medicine Corp. ("BPM") announces another major triumph in its Southeast Asian expansion. Its proprietary innovative in vitro diagnostic (IVD) test, DNlite-IVD103, has been granted marketing authorization by the Ministry of Health (MOH) of Vietnam. The approved indication is for the risk assessment and prediction of Diabetic Kidney Disease (DKD) in patients with Type 2 diabetes.

A Massive Unmet Need and Changing Global Guidelines
Statistics indicate that about 50% of dialysis patients reach end-stage renal disease due to DKD. Recognizing the massive unmet medical need in current diagnostic practices, the international medical community continues to strongly advocate for the use of biomarker testing to improve existing care models and has begun focusing on the necessity of revising global clinical care and treatment guidelines.
Accelerating Global Adoption
DNlite-IVD103 is the world's first ELISA-based diagnostic test designed to prevent the rapid progression of DKD. Prior to this, the test had already obtained market authorizations in multiple EU countries, Taiwan, Malaysia, Thailand, Saudi Arabia, and the United Arab Emirates. The recent approval in Vietnam further demonstrates that DNlite-IVD103 has been widely recognized by the international medical community and is being progressively adopted into standard clinical practice.
Capitalizing on Vietnam's Surging Healthcare Demand
According to data from the International Diabetes Federation (IDF), the diabetic population in Vietnam exceeded 3.99 million in 2021, with a prevalence rate of 6.1%—a figure that has doubled over the past decade. The Vietnamese government's diabetes-related healthcare expenditures reached a staggering $1.67 billion USD, highlighting a massive underlying demand for precision medical services and diagnostics. Following the successful market authorization of DNlite-IVD103, BPM will actively formulate subsequent market strategies to drive robust revenue growth and commercial momentum in the region.
